The Instructors
Chief Larry Hesser (ret.) served 39 years in LE with 29 as a Chief of Police in Georgia, Colorado, North Carolina and Texas. He is well known as a leadership trainer nationwide.
Chief Mike Alexander (ret.) served 25 years with Austin Police Department, retiring as a Sergeant overseeing APD’s Leadership Command College. He has served as a Chief of Police and a Major with the State Officer of Inspector General.
